What does a cath lab manager do?

Your job duties as a cath lab manager include overseeing the operations in a cardiac catheterization laboratory. Your responsibilities may consist of hiring employees, scheduling, and ensuring that the lab provides support to cardiologists and surgery teams before, during, and after a procedure. In this career, your focus is on organizing many aspects of patient care and, in some cases, working to ensure the quality of nursing care for patients. As a manager, you also ensure that clinical operations meet regulations and industry stand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a cath lab man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Cath Lab Manager, you need expertise in cardiovascular procedures, leadership experience, and a background in nursing or allied health, often supported by a BSN or RCIS certification. Familiarity with cath lab imaging systems, inventory management software, and regulatory compliance standards is essential. Strong communication, decision-making, and organizational skills help manage teams and coordinate complex procedures. These competencies ensure efficient operations, quality patient care, and adherence to safety and regulatory requirements in a high-stakes environment.

What are some common challenges faced by a cath lab manager, and how can they be addressed?

Cath Lab Managers often face challenges related to coordinating complex schedules, maintaining high standards of patient care, and ensuring regulatory compliance. Balancing the needs of physicians, nursing staff, and patients requires strong communication and organizational skills. Additionally, managing equipment maintenance, inventory, and staying updated with evolving technologies are ongoing tasks. Successfully addressing these challenges involves fostering a collaborative team environment, implementing efficient workflows, and prioritizing continuous staff education and training.

What is the difference between Cath Lab Manager vs Cath Lab Technologist?

AspectCath Lab ManagerCath Lab Technologist
CredentialsRN or Allied Health Degree, Leadership CertificationRegistered Nurse (RN) or Radiologic Technologist Certification
Work EnvironmentCardiac catheterization labs, overseeing staff and operationsPerforming diagnostic and interventional procedures in cath labs
ResponsibilitiesManaging staff, budgets, and patient care protocolsAssisting with procedures, operating imaging equipment

The Cath Lab Manager primarily oversees the lab's operations and staff, requiring leadership skills and management credentials. In contrast, the Cath Lab Technologist focuses on performing diagnostic and interventional procedures, requiring specialized technical certifications. Both roles work closely within the cath lab environment but differ in responsibilities and scope.
